#2e0192 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2e0192 is composed of 18% red, 0.4% green and 57.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68.5% cyan, 99.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 42.7% black. It has a hue angle of 258.6 degrees, a saturation of 98.6% and a lightness of 28.8%. #2e0192 color hex could be obtained by blending #5c02ff with #000025.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

#2e0192 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2e0192 has RGB values of R:46, G:1, B:146 and CMYK values of C:0.68, M:0.99, Y:0, K:0.43. Its decimal value is 3015058.
